Al-Hikma al-mutaaliya fi l-asfar al-aqliyya al-arbaa (book)

In the landscape of Islamic philosophy, few texts resonate with the profundity and sophistication of “Al-Hikma al-mutaaliya fi l-asfar al-aqliyya al-arbaa.” This magnum opus, authored by the eminent philosopher Mulla Sadra, is not merely a philosophical treatise; it is a remarkable exploration of the intersection of reason and spirituality, seeking to elucidate the vast terrains of existence through an intricate dialogue between intellect and intuition. Mulla Sadra’s discourse is imbued with a unique appeal that captivates scholars, philosophers, and seekers alike.

At its core, this work dissects the premises of existence and being, introducing the reader to a metaphysical journey that is both enlightening and, at times, bewildering. The title itself hints at its thematic focal points – “Al-Hikma” translates to “wisdom,” while “al-mutaaliya” expresses an elevated, transcendent form of understanding. With “asfar al-aqliyya al-arbaa,” the phrase refers to the four intellectual journeys that weave together the fabric of existence and knowledge. These journeys are the quintessence through which the cosmos is both rationally examined and spiritually realized.

The first journey, “asfar al-aqliyya,” permits the philosopher to embark on a profound exploration of the nature of being. Here, Mulla Sadra presents us with the seminal concept of “substantial motion,” which proposes that being is in a constant state of transformation. Unlike traditional Aristotelian perspectives that perceive existence as static and unchanging, Mulla Sadra’s paradigm invigorates the notion of being with dynamic vitality. This text vividly imparts how existence evolves and morphs, akin to a river that flows ceaselessly, shaping landscapes while remaining itself.

The second journey unfolds to reveal the interplay between the corporeal and the incorporeal. Mulla Sadra adeptly navigates through the dualities of necessity and contingency, essence and existence. He posits that all things possess an essence that is distinct from their existence; however, the understanding of both is interdependent. This intricate relationship is metaphorically akin to the moon illuminating the night sky, casting reflections that shape our perception without being diminished by their illumination. The reader gains insight into how the essence of a thing informs its existential reality, promoting a deeper appreciation that transcends superficial understanding.
